It turns out there was more background to the Shinya Aoki Vs Viento Maligno match than I first thought. Before the King Of DDT tournament began, Aoki allegedly made a prediction that Maligno would unmask and compete in Best Of The Super Jr. so both of them could have a match between tournament winners. Aoki lived up to his end of the idea which is why after he won King Of DDT he called out Maligno and told him everybody knows what he is doing. They had a match today where Maligno tried to counter the Aoki Clutch but Aoki switched over to a Modified Butterfly Lock to make the luchador give up. He then ripped the mask off Maligno’s face to reveal it was Keigo Nakamura the whole time! Nakamura admitted his real identity and explained that he couldn’t adapt to wrestling in Mexico during his excursion. Even now he does not know who he is and his confidence has disappeared after he saw how all of his juniors have surpassed him. However he still gets support from everybody in Strange Love Connection and he wants to become stronger by being with them. Aoki asked him what will he do from now on and who does he want to fight? Nakamura put the mask back on and will continue to wrestle as Viento Maligno because he’s hit rock bottom has nothing else to lose.

The opening match was officially Sanshiro Takagi’s return to action in DDT (as long as you ignore Super Japan). He feels so reenergised from his time off that he asked for the match to be Best 2 Out Of 3 Falls with no time limit applied. The 37KAMIINA agreed and quickly tried to injure him again. However he blocked Shunma Katsumata’s Totonou Splash and then Cradled him to win the first fall. He then declared the 2nd Fall would be Falls Count Anywhere. For the next two hours Takagi, Akito, Yuki Ueno and Katsumata brawled all over Shinjuku FACE and even outside on the street. Since the action was happening away from ringside, DDT decided to go on with the show and it wasn’t until the very end when the opening match returned to the ring and Takagi pinned Katsumata again to win the match in two straight falls.

Takagi said this comeback could not have been possible if it wasn’t for the other wrestlers in the match and he is feeling super pumped about winning. He’s been cheating on DDT a little bit with Super Japan but he thinks DDT is the best and he is super motivated to wrestle here again. There is one guy in particular he wants to wrestle again to reignite his passion even more. It is MAO, who he hasn’t fought against one on one since 2019 in New York! He challenged MAO to a singles match on 28th June. MAO agreed and blamed Takagi for making him the wrestler he is today. So all of the times he tried to run Takagi over with a car is really Takagi’s fault.

DDT will be holding a pro wrestling event attached to the Kumagawa Railway in Kumamoto on 22nd November. The Kumagawa Railway has been under repairs due to storm damage ever since the summer of 2020. This year those repairs will be completed and it is scheduled to finally reopen this September. DDT is celebrating the occasion by holding two matches to take place inside the train along with an actual wrestling show taking place at the journey’s destination Yunomae Station.

Having a Beer Garden show means everybody goes there to get drunk, right? Not always. Yuki Ueno & Chris Brookes made a request for today’s main event to be a Drunk Rules match. However Danshoku Dieno is currently avoiding alcohol for his health and refused to be irresponsible about it. Hisaya Imabayashi agreed it would be a bad move for DDT to force one of their wrestlers to drink when they do not want to and came up with a compromise. A Drunk Match would go ahead for Ueno and Brookes but Dieno would be allowed to drink cola instead when prompted to. Yuki Ishida was also permitted to drink on Yoshihiko’s behalf. The wrestlers would have to drink after every kickout, rope break or if music suddenly played during the match. Dieno brought Yoshihiko up to the top of a ladder while everybody held it steady for their safety (a hot topic in puroresu this week due to the same actions happening at the Best Of The Super Jr.) until Brookes decided to topple Yoshihiko over. A brawl around the arena also resulted in Yoshihiko diving off of the top of the lighting rig. Dieno drinking cola instead of alcohol brought up an unintended consequence of needing to use the bathroom so he had to abandon his tag partner for a while. When he returned armed with toilet paper, Dieno had to fight off Ueno & Brookes on his own until Yoshihiko reappeared wrapped in empty beer cans and diving into the ring. Brookes tried to force Dieno to drink alcohol but Dieno used the Lip Lock to pass the drink over to Ueno. He then made Ueno and Brookes Lip Lock each other then attacked Brookes to make him spit out the beer. Dieno & Yoshihiko then applied a Double Gaydo Clutch on Brookes to win the match after over half an hour of mayhem. DDT have found a way to guarantee that the Iron Man Heavymetalweight Champion will show up at Sumo Hall this August. Whoever holds the title going into the show will be rewarded with a one year long Shinkansen Box Office pass. This pass will allow the holder to travel on the bullet train at no personal cost whenever DDT books them for one of their regional shows in a twelve month period that begins after the show. The mixed rules fight between Bushimasa and Tyson Maeguchi was a two round contest. The first round was MMA rules that lasted for three minutes. Then the second round was Tyre Boxing Rules where a tyre was placed in the middle of the ring and they had to fight while keeping one foot each inside the tyre hole. Maeguchi punched Bushimasa out of the tyre three times to earn a TKO style victory.

Super Japan is feeling a little more secure in its future so it is taking another one of DDT’s well tested ideas, the Beer Garden show. Along with that is the return of another Sanshiro Takagi project, the Unpaid Rumble! It is a match open to wrestlers of all shapes, sizes and backgrounds as long as they are willing to take part without being paid anything. Takagi is presenting this as maybe the last chance for some wrestlers to ever have a match inside Shinjuku FACE before it closes down later this year.

Today is the last time the a King Of DDT round will be held inside Shinjuku FACE before the venue closes down later this year. It was the Quarter Finals with eight wrestlers still remaining in the tournament. Shinya Aoki knocked out a former two-time winner HARASHIMA in the main event. HARASHIMA countered Aoki’s submission game by hitting the Somato twice but Aoki kicked out of the pin both times. Aoki then used the ropes to prevent HARASHIMA from using the rare Yama-ori finisher. Instead Aoki put him in position for the dreaded European Clutch, ultimately winning the struggle to pin HARASHIMA’s shoulders for the three count.

A brawl broke out between Chris Brookes and Minoru Suzuki early on in their match. Suzuki got the advantage by hurting Brookes’s left leg with a chair and then targeting it from around ringside. The plan worked out when Brookes repeatedly went for Penalty Kicks using his left leg, reducing the effectiveness of the move until Suzuki could block a kick and grab Brookes into a Heel Hold for the instant submission victory. Suzuki looked like he was going to show Brookes respect after the match by reaching out his hand but it was only so he could grab his leg one more time and slam it against the canvas.
